Red Africa
Red Africa relates the history of the influence exerted by the USSR over many African states between 1960 and 1990, working from extraordinary archival footage filmed by Soviet operators. The subtle editing of restored images reveals the hidden agenda of the USSR which, under the cloak of generosity, was aspiring to expand its socialist “paradise”.
Directed by Alexander Markov
